In 1962 Starr replaced Best as drummer for the Beatles. The band became quite popular, and it was during a shared 1960 engagement in Hamburg, West Germany, that Starr became acquainted with the Beatles ( John Lennon, Paul McCartney, George Harrison, and Pete Best). In 1959 he became the drummer for another skiffle band, Rory Storm and the Hurricanes, and adopted his stage name. Starkey did not return to school after his release from the sanatorium but worked at various jobs, eventually becoming an apprentice joiner for an engineering company, where he and other employees formed a skiffle band. During the latter episode he was introduced to the drums by a health worker who gave children musical instruments to amuse them. Frequently ill, he spent a year in the hospital with complications from a burst appendix when he was six years old and a further two years in a sanatorium after he acquired pleurisy at the age of 13. ![]() His parents, both bakery workers, divorced when he was a small child. Starkey was born in a working-class area of Liverpool. Ringo Starr, byname of Sir Richard Starkey, (born July 7, 1940, Liverpool, Merseyside, England), British musician, singer, songwriter, and actor who was the drummer for the Beatles, one of the most influential bands in rock history. Since the 1990s, Ringo has toured with " Ringo Starr & His All-Starr Band". He also made a movie with the Beatles called A Hard Day's Night in 1964. He also narrated the children's show Thomas the Tank Engine and Friends for the first two seasons (1984-1986). Conductor on the children's show Shining Time Station, during its first season (1989), the Comedian George Carlin later took over the role. Starr acted in several movies aside from the ones he did with the Beatles, including The Magic Christian (1969), That'll Be The Day (1973), Caveman (1980), and the role of Mr. Ringo sang "I Want To Be A Powerpuff Girl" for the childrens television show " The Powerpuff Girls". He sang lead on some of the band's songs including " Yellow Submarine", "Act Naturally", "Don't Pass Me By", and " Octopus's Garden".Īfter the group broke up he became a solo artist his songs included "It Don't Come Easy", "Photograph" (written with George Harrison), "You're Sixteen" (featuring Paul McCartney and Harry Nilsson), and "Only You (And You Alone)" (with John Lennon and again with Nilsson). He quickly became well-liked and very popular. He joined the group in 1962 as a replacement for their first drummer Pete Best. He is known as a former member of the Beatles. The trail crosses a flood control area and begins zigzagging its way up the southwest base of Echo Mountain. Now the land houses several miles of equestrian trails, a small botanical garden, and the entrance to the Echo Mountain Trail. Luckily, students from the aptly named John Muir High School bought the land and donated it to the Forest Service. One year later, the Marx Brothers bought the land and wanted to turn the area into a cemetery. The Cobb Estate belonged to a wealthy lumber magnate, and had several gold mines and water wells on its property before the buildings were completely razed in 1959. The theater and hotel were built as an anchor of a once vibrant commercial district in South Shore. Jeffery Theater Building and Spencer Arms Hotelġ924, William P. ![]() “The individual building losses appear isolated, but when viewed from a wider perspective. The result is often a slow but steady loss of these buildings,” the organization said. “Terra cotta commercial buildings in neighborhoods across Chicago continue to be threatened by disinvestment and new development pressures. But smaller terra cotta buildings scattered throughout the city are unrecognized and unprotected, Preservation Chicago said. The “golden age” of terra cotta usage left a significant mark on Chicago buildings, and many stunning examples in the Loop and Downtown have been landmarked. Terra cotta buildings like this one in Albany Park are often overlooked for landmark status and preservation.
